Kick back occurs when the timing of the ignition system fires too early during the compression stroke. When the air and fuel mixture ignites, it forces the piston back down the cylinder bore in the opposite direction of rotation at a tremendous speed. oriel harwood photo https://mayaraguimaraes.com

WHEN I WENT TO START IT THE PULL CORD RIPPED OUT … A lawnmower engine commonly kicks back when the shear key breaks. The shear key commonly breaks because the blade has kit a solid object and come to a sudden stop. Web22 feb. 2024 · Feb 21, 2024 / Pull start kick back #5 If this is a push mower engine, is the blade installed. The blade also acts like a flywheel, and without it the aluminum flywheel doesn't have enough mass to overcome the compression and the force of the piston trying to go back down when the spark plug ignites the fuel mix in the cylinder. Web2 mrt. 2024 · If an l-head remove the carburetor and breather cover, pull the rope and watch the valve stems. The exhaust valve should bump as the piston comes up on the compression stroke. If ohv remove the valve cover. Also check valve clearance.
